Mongolia is a country present process an unbelievable amount of change. Last 12 months, in 2011, that they had the fastest rising financial system in the world, with a 17.2% enhance of their GDP, based on the World Bank. A mere 22 years in the past, Mongolia was a communist nation, and right now they’re a parliamentary democracy. The nation has opened itself up to the relaxation of the world and a free market economic system, and skilled a very drastic shift in this path within the early 1990’s. Many Mongolians will inform you that the mindset of Mongolia’s residents has made a drastic shift since communism and socialism. One woman gave me an instance of this shift when she stated that during socialism, all kids shared their toys with one another, but now children are very possessive of their belongings and think in a extra individualistic method. If this change has even effected how youngsters play with one another, it’s comprehensible that it has additionally affected other areas of society.

“You’re pretty much out on the steppe by yourself the men needed to discover ways to do the women’s jobs and the women needed to learn how to do the men’s job,” says May. While men historically protected the camp and women cared for the tribe’s herds, everybody had to be ready to choose up the slack, particularly if an enemy tribe decided to raid your personal. Just as they’d have centuries ago, young Mongolian women nonetheless be taught to ride horses as toddlers today. Jeanne Menjoulet/ CC BY 2.0Under Chinggis Khan, the Mongols cast the largest contiguous land empire ever known. According to some estimates, it stretched a mind-boggling twelve million square miles throughout Asia, from modern-day Poland to South Korea. The Mongols’ success had everything to do with their driving and archery skills.

Weddings in Mongolia are one of the most influential days of a person and woman’s life together. Weddings are celebrated events that at occasions are much more essential than births or deaths. In the previous, historical past explains that Mongolian women were often married as young women of ages about 13 to 14. In modern-day, those with much less cash normally marry in their earlier 20s, whereas those extra city marry later of their 20s and 30s. Mongolians normally had organized marriages and once a man is married he’s not allowed to marry thereafter. Dating just isn’t as common for these with less cash such as herders, but intercourse previous to marriage is practiced.
